Arrest warrant issued for Youngstown man accused of passing bad checks


BOARDMAN — Township police have issued an arrest warrant for Desmond Clark, 32, of Youngstown, for passing bad checks and theft by deception.

Clark was identified in line-ups by victims who reported that Clark approached them, claimed not to have an ID and asked them to cash checks for him.

Three victims were approached at the Southern Park Mall, 7401 Market St., and a Shell station, 5135 Market.

The victims were later notified by their banks that the checks were bad.

Clark was arrested for similar incidents that happened in July. He was accused of stealing gas station gift cards and then selling them to victims.

Clark pleaded not guilty in August to charges of theft and theft by deception.

He is scheduled to appear in court for a pretrial hearing on those charges Oct. 7.
